Stephen Jones Travels Home With Collection Inspired by Wales

PRINCE OF WALES: With three out of 4 Welsh grandparents, it was about time that milliner Stephen Jones turned his attention to his ancestral home. He actually went all-out, calling the gathering “Cymru,” the Welsh name for Wales, and adding the hills, valleys, rivers and iconography of the Celtic country to his dramatic designs for the spring 2024 season. In an interview, the designer said he was proud to big up the small country, which hardly gets any attention in the style world. “Everybody does ‘Scottish,’ and Ireland is widely known — especially in America. Prada Mode Travels to Tokyo

MILAN — Prada Mode shall be traveling to Tokyo on May 12 and 13. The ninth iteration of the architectural and cultural activation will happen in association with the Tokyo metropolitan government and the Teien Art Museum, one in all Japan’s fundamental institutions. Prada Mode Tokyo shall be hosted and curated by award-winning architect and longtime Prada collaborator Kazuyo Sejima, the director of the Teien Art Museum.
